    In this episode of Branching Out: Where Real Estate Meets Real Life, Christina sits down with Carolena and Brad Barringer — a husband-and-wife investing team who’ve built a real estate business together through long-term rentals, short-term rentals, flips, land, and new construction.

    Their journey didn’t start with confidence or a perfect plan.

    It started with budgeting, faith, and a willingness to take action before everything felt “ready.”

    In this conversation, they share:
    • How Financial Peace University reshaped their mindset around money
    • Their very first rental — and why they “got lucky”
    • The rehab that went 100% over budget and changed how they invest forever
    • Why investing is not passive — and how systems make it manageable
    • How they decide when to flip, hold, or build
    • What it’s really like to invest together as a married couple
    • Why mentorship and community accelerated their growth
    • How real estate gave them time freedom — and purpose

    Ever stayed in an Airbnb and thought: “How much does this place actually earn… and could I do this?”

    In this episode, Christina sits down with Dawon Millwood (Concord local + STR owner/operator) for an honest conversation on short-term rentals: what the numbers look like, what the work really is, and how to know if STRs fit your 2026 investing goals.

    You’ll hear about:
    ✅ How Dawon went from W-2 to real estate (and what she learned the hard way)
    ✅ How she built a team (cleaners + maintenance) that keeps properties running
    ✅ Pricing strategy, occupancy expectations, and guest communication
    ✅ When STR management makes sense — and when it doesn’t
    ✅ Why she charges 15% (and what most managers charge instead)

    Bonus: Dawon also shares what it’s been like buying and renovating a downtown Concord commercial building—and why Local Bottle Shop is becoming part of our 2026 Branch community gatherings.

    In this episode of Branching Out: Where Real Estate Meets Real Life, we sit down with Jamie Richardson — Director of Marketing, Events, and Communications at Cooperative Christian Ministry and candidate for Kannapolis City Council — to talk about growth, community, and what it takes to shape a thriving city.

    From her years serving on the Planning & Zoning Commission, Chamber of Commerce, and countless community boards, Jamie has seen firsthand what responsible development looks like — and where Kannapolis is headed next.

    💡 In this conversation, you’ll learn:
    ✅ How Kannapolis has transformed from a mill town to a booming hub for families and small businesses
    ✅ What’s next for downtown development and key corridors like Highway 29
    ✅ Why balanced growth and community engagement are vital for the city’s future
    ✅ How affordable housing, transportation, and tourism all fit into the next chapter of growth

    Jamie shares her insights on leadership that listens, community partnerships, and the importance of keeping Kannapolis united as it continues to expand.
